My approach to therapy

I am aware of the multiple, complex influences on a client’s mental health (biology, past history, trauma, emotions, thoughts, self-image, relationships). However, my approach starts very simply: ‘What would you like to achieve?’ and ‘What is getting in your way right now?’ I listen, I ask questions, I draw connections, I check in with you to make sure I’m on the right track. I gently push you to take the next small step, to understand yourself better, to accept more of yourself. I would describe my therapy style as integrative-humanistic, which means I draw inspiration from many different kinds of therapy, but I always center the whole person sitting in front of me.

What you can expect from me

First, I recognize that you will have already taken the biggest step by the time I first meet you. It takes courage to ask for help, and your own motivation to get better will be a powerful force in our work together. I want you to know that therapy is a safe space, and that I will accept you no matter what you’ve gone through, what you feel, or what you think about. I will ask you some questions about your life, your current struggles, and your strengths to develop an accurate picture of the problems you are experiencing. I will help you identify some initial goals for therapy, and I will outline how we can work toward those goals together. And, if you have any questions or concerns along the way, I want to hear about them! Therapy only works if it works for you.
